June 4 (reporter Zhao Jialin) The European Commission Trade Commissioner Ashton and U.S. Trade Representative Kirk 4th at the opening of the 13th session of the St. Petersburg International Economic Forum, said that the negotiations on Russia's accession to the World Trade Organization is expected to end at the end of this year. Ashton and Russia's economic development Minister Nabiulina after a meeting said Russia may join the World Trade Organization by the end of 2009. Ashton on the same day after meeting with Russia's first deputy Prime minister Shuvalov said that Russia's accession to the WTO will be of great significance. Speaking at a Russian-American business dialogue in the framework of the St. Petersburg International Economic Forum, Kirk said negotiations on Russia's accession to the WTO had made great strides, and negotiations could end at the end of this year. Russia is currently one of the few major economies in the world that has yet to join the WTO. Negotiations on Russia's accession to the WTO have lasted more than 15 years.
